The area of a trapezium is `352 cm^(2)` and the distance between its parallel sides is 16 cm. If one of the parallel sides is of length 25 cm, find the length of the other.

To solve the problem step by step, we will use the formula for the area of a trapezium. The area \( A \) of a trapezium can be calculated using the formula: \[ A = \frac{1}{2} \times (a + b) \times h \] where: - \( a \) and \( b \) are the lengths of the parallel sides, - \( h \) is the distance between the parallel sides. ### Step 1: Identify the known values We know: - Area \( A = 352 \, \text{cm}^2 \) - Distance between parallel sides \( h = 16 \, \text{cm} \) - One parallel side \( a = 25 \, \text{cm} \) - Let the length of the other parallel side be \( b = x \). ### Step 2: Substitute the known values into the area formula Using the area formula, we can substitute the known values: \[ 352 = \frac{1}{2} \times (25 + x) \times 16 \] ### Step 3: Simplify the equation First, simplify the right side of the equation: \[ 352 = \frac{1}{2} \times (25 + x) \times 16 \] Calculating \( \frac{1}{2} \times 16 \): \[ 352 = 8 \times (25 + x) \] ### Step 4: Expand the equation Now, distribute \( 8 \): \[ 352 = 200 + 8x \] ### Step 5: Isolate \( x \) To find \( x \), we need to isolate it on one side of the equation. First, subtract \( 200 \) from both sides: \[ 352 - 200 = 8x \] This simplifies to: \[ 152 = 8x \] ### Step 6: Solve for \( x \) Now, divide both sides by \( 8 \): \[ x = \frac{152}{8} \] Calculating the division: \[ x = 19 \] ### Step 7: State the final answer The length of the other parallel side \( b \) is: \[ b = 19 \, \text{cm} \] ### Summary The length of the other parallel side of the trapezium is \( 19 \, \text{cm} \). ---
